2. Distribution companies are intended to aid the release of a film, along with its marketing.
When negotiating the rights of a film with a distributor, certain points are discussed such
as: the territory the film is distributed in; the time frame in which the distributor has
rights over the film; the rights granted to the distributor; the gross income the distributor
receives; and the means by which the agreement can be terminated.

3. We have chosen Momentum Pictures to distribute our film. They have produced several
Thriller films, pictured above. For this reason we decided they would be a good company to
go with, as our film is a Thriller film that will contain action and psychological elements. In
addition, Wikipedia describes them as ‘one of the leading independent motion picture
distributors in the UK’, which shows they are not only based in the same country as our
film, but are independent rather than part of a synergy.
As Momentum Pictures are based in the UK, and have become very successful, we will
make residents of the UK our main target audience, however we will also expand to wider
audiences such as the U.S.A. for their interest in Thriller and Action films.

4. We would like our film to be advertised to our target audience successfully.
As our target audience is males between the ages of 18 and 30, we need to
ensure our advertisements are displayed at optimum hours – primarily after
during work travel times, and late night TV when the majority of males will have
returned from work, as well as students relaxing from university.
The film will be released in cinemas, as opening weekend revenues can be
high for successful films. This will need to tie in with our advertising well, in
order to promote the cinema viewings to the target audience.
